Buyer's Representation Services

At iLotus Realty, we provide our buyer clients with comprehensive, professional representation throughout every stage of the home-buying process. The following outlines the full scope of services our Agents deliver to ensure a seamless and successful transaction.

Initial Buyer Consultation

  • Respond promptly to prospective buyer inquiries.
  • Conduct an introductory interview to understand the buyer’s goals, gather essential personal information, and explain the home-buying process in detail.
  • Verify that no conflicting brokerage relationships or other conflicts of interest exist.
  • Review the mortgage pre-approval process and its importance.
  • Recommend at least three reputable mortgage lenders to assist with pre-approval.
  • Identify the buyer’s preferences, including location, price range, size, property type, special requirements, and ADA accommodations.

Pre-Contract Activities

  • Obtain and review the buyer’s pre-approval letter from the lender.
  • Search the MLS for properties matching the buyer’s criteria.
  • Schedule property showings with sellers or listing brokers.
  • Accompany the buyer to view selected properties.

Offer and Contract Activities

  • Obtain a good-faith estimate from the buyer’s lender for the target purchase price and review it with the buyer.
  • Review the offer, contract forms, addenda, and related documents with the buyer.
  • Prepare the offer to purchase along with all required addenda.
  • Provide the buyer with the seller’s disclosure forms.
  • Submit the signed offer to the seller’s broker.
  • Furnish credit report information to the seller in the case of seller financing.
  • Provide the buyer with copies of all forms used in the offer.
  • Negotiate all offers and counteroffers on the buyer’s behalf.
  • Prepare and deliver counteroffers, acceptances, or amendments to the seller’s broker.
  • Verify that the final contract is properly signed, initialed, and accompanied by all required documents.
  • Deliver the fully executed contract to the buyer.
  • Distribute signed contracts to all parties involved, including the buyer, seller, title company, lender, cooperating brokers, and closing agent.
  • Record and promptly deposit earnest money into the appropriate escrow account or deliver it to the closing agent, obtaining a receipt.
  • Provide the receipt of escrow deposit to the seller’s broker.
  • File a copy of the signed contract in the office records.
  • Notify the buyer of any additional offers received between the effective date and closing.
  • Update the listing file to reflect “sale pending” status.

Home and Termite (WDO) Inspection

  • Provide the buyer with at least three home inspection and three WDO inspection company referrals.
  • Coordinate professional home and WDO inspections with the seller’s broker.
  • Review all inspection reports with the buyer.
  • Document completed inspections in the listing file.
  • Order additional inspections (septic, well, mold) when applicable.
  • Review supplemental inspection reports with the buyer and assess their impact on the sale.
  • Distribute copies of any septic, well, or mold reports to the lender and seller.
  • Verify the seller’s compliance with all agreed-upon repair requirements.

Loan Process Tracking

  • Coordinate with the lender regarding discount points and lock-in dates.
  • Confirm receipt of deposit and employment verifications.
  • Contact the lender weekly to ensure loan processing remains on schedule.
  • Follow the loan through underwriting.
  • Communicate final loan approval to the seller.

Appraisal

  • Schedule the appraisal with the seller or seller’s broker.
  • Advise the buyer of available options if the appraisal differs from the contract price.
  • Provide comparable sales data to the appraiser as needed.
  • Follow up until the appraisal is completed.
  • Document appraisal completion in the listing file.

Closing Preparation

  • Coordinate the closing process with the seller’s broker, lender, and closing agent.
  • Maintain and update all closing forms and files.
  • Confirm that all parties have the necessary documentation to close.
  • Assist with obtaining power of attorney or trust documentation when required.
  • Work with the seller’s broker to schedule and conduct the buyer’s final walk-through.
  • Confirm receipt of the title insurance commitment.
  • Confirm the closing location, date, and time, and notify all parties.
  • Verify with the closing agent that all tax, HOA, utility, and other prorations have been resolved.
  • Request and review final closing figures from the closing agent.
  • Review the HUD statement with the buyer to confirm all figures are accurate.
  • Forward verified closing figures to the seller’s broker for confirmation.
  • Verify that the homeowner’s warranty, if purchased, is provided at closing.
  • Forward closing documents to absentee buyers when applicable.
  • Deliver the earnest money deposit from escrow to the closing agent, ensuring it is properly reflected on the final HUD.
  • Confirm the availability of collected funds for closing.
  • Explain the homestead exemption filing process.
  • Verify the transfer of all keys, garage-door openers, HOA and security access codes, pool equipment, and appliance manuals.
  • Close out the listing file.

After-Closing Services

  • Assist with filing homeowner’s warranty claims upon request.
  • Respond to follow-up inquiries and provide additional information from office files as needed.
  • Follow up with the buyer to ensure continued satisfaction.
